I compiled a vanilla 2.6.15 kernel last week, on a Dell (Poweredge 2650) server (which is in constant usage), ever since the load average has stayed solid at > 1.
There is nothing interesting in the process list, the only thing which changed is the kernel.
Does anyone know any kernel gotchyas which cause this kind of behavious? |

Having had a better google around I found people reporting it with the CONFIG_DELL_RBU option.
I will have to recompile and swap the new kernel in when I can grab some downtime... |
